Weeping Tile Repair in Warwick, RI
Weeping tile repair services focus on maintaining the drainage system installed around a property’s foundation to prevent water intrusion and structural damage. This system typically consists of perforated pipes and gravel that direct excess water away from the foundation. Repairs may be necessary if there are signs of water pooling near the foundation, foundation cracks, or if the drainage system becomes clogged or damaged over time. Property owners often seek these services to address existing drainage issues or to prevent future water-related problems that could compromise the stability of the home.
Before requesting weeping tile repair,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work involved, including whether the entire drainage system needs replacement or if localized repairs will suffice. It’s also helpful to know what signs indicate a potential problem, such as basement flooding or persistent dampness. Understanding the process, potential disruptions, and the importance of proper drainage can assist homeowners in making informed decisions to protect their property’s foundation and overall structural integrity.

Weeping Tile Repair Questions
What is weeping tile used for? Weeping tile helps direct excess water away from a foundation to prevent flooding and water damage.
How do I know if my weeping tile needs repair? Signs include persistent basement dampness, water pooling around the foundation, or visible cracks in the foundation wall.
What causes weeping tile to fail? Common causes include clogging from debris, shifting soil, or deterioration of the pipe material over time.
Can damaged weeping tile be repaired or does it need replacement? Minor issues may be repairable, but extensive damage often requires replacing sections of the system.
